1337 speak

1337 speak origins from leet which origins from elite. Leet was just short for elite at that time. People consider being "l33t" is an internet way of being "cool". Like the first example below.

The origin of leet speak is as follows:

leet comes from:
Elite » leet » 1337

Words like "plz" come from:
Please » pleas » ples » pls » plz

Well I got to go » Got to go » gotta
go » got 2 go » gtg » g2g

What's up? » Wasup? » Sup?

I'm laughing out loud! » I'm loling! » lol

I'll be right back » I'll b right back » I'll b rite bac » brb

I own you, I win » You are owned. » (Historic typo word) You got pwned » Total pwnage » Pwned.

So on and so forth. Some of these "leet" internet words come from slang talk just like the example "wasup?". Most people also like to change letter around like "newbie » n00b" same with using numbers instead of letters. Which makes l33t. Some of them also come from the pronounciation of words. Like below:

Are » R
You » U
Cause » cuz

And so on. What makes leet speak so unique is how it has evolved over the years and how it is used in games.

trucker-speak

A set of terms that everyday truck drivers use and are also stereotyped to be used by truck drivers.

Some well-known trucker terms:

Evel Knievel: A motorcycle cop.

City Kitty: A local city cop, same thing as a local yokel.

Local Yokel: A local city cop, the same as a city kitty.

County Mounty (also spelled County Mountie): A county sheriff or sheriff's deputy.

Smokey Bear (or just Bear): A state trooper or highway patrol officer.
